Model 552 speedmaster case head separation

I was given a 552 brand new in early 60's by my dad. It had a tag on it "use Remington ammunition only" and I figured that was just a sales gimmick. Not so. Have fired thousands of rounds of Remington brand ammo with no problems over the years. Any other brand in long rifle will result in the cartridge head missing and the casing left like a tube in the chamber within 1 to 3 rounds. Dangerous gas and debris leaving out the ejection port, not to mention your ears ringing. Any brand short seems to work ok, but not long rifle. This started from day one. I would like to fix this if possible for my grand kid but I want it safe. Could headspace be the problem and if so would a new bolt be the cure? I think Remington ammo must have a thicker gauge brass for their .22 ammo.l
